Chicken Casserole

Description

A delicious and easy-to-make chicken casserole with a flaky crust and a flavorful filling of chicken and vegetables.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 2 cups mixed vegetables (peas, carrots, corn)
  • 1 cup cream of chicken soup
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 package refrigerated pie crusts or puff pastry

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Combine the cooked chicken, mixed vegetables, cream of chicken soup, chicken broth, garlic powder, onion powder, thyme, salt, and pepper in a large mixing bowl until well mixed.
  3. Roll out the pie crusts or puff pastry and fit one into a greased casserole dish.
  4. Pour the chicken mixture into the casserole dish, spreading it evenly.
  5. Cover with the second pie crust or puff pastry, sealing the edges and cutting slits in the top for steam to escape.
  6.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until the crust is golden brown.
  7.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.

Notes

Make sure to mix the filling thoroughly for balanced flavors. You can substitute mixed vegetables based on your preference.
